Ingredients for Beef Stew Recipe Hawaii
To create an authentic Beef Stew Recipe Hawaii, you'll need a variety of ingredients that bring together the essence of Hawaiian cuisine with the heartiness of a traditional beef stew. Here’s what you’ll need:
- 2 lbs beef stew meat, cut into cubes
- 2 tablespoons vegetable oil
- 1 large onion, chopped
- 3 cloves garlic, minced
- 2 carrots, peeled and chopped
- 2 potatoes, peeled and chopped
- 1 cup frozen peas
- 1 cup frozen corn
- 1 can (14.5 oz) diced tomatoes
- 2 cups beef broth
- 1 tablespoon soy sauce
- 1 tablespoon Worcestershire sauce
- 1 teaspoon dried thyme
- 1 teaspoon dried rosemary
- 1 teaspoon salt
- 1/2 teaspoon black pepper
- 1/2 cup pineapple juice
- 1/2 cup coconut milk
- 1 tablespoon cornstarch
- 2 tablespoons water
- Fresh cilantro for garnish
Instructions for Beef Stew Recipe Hawaii
Creating a Beef Stew Recipe Hawaii involves several steps, but the process is straightforward and the result is a deeply satisfying dish. Follow these instructions to make your own:
Step 1: Brown the Beef
In a large Dutch oven or heavy-bottomed pot, heat the vegetable oil over medium-high heat. Add the beef cubes and brown them on all sides. This step is crucial for developing the rich flavors that will infuse the stew.
🍲 Note: Be sure not to overcrowd the pot. Brown the beef in batches if necessary.
Step 2: Sauté the Vegetables
Once the beef is browned, remove it from the pot and set it aside. In the same pot, add the chopped onion and sauté until it becomes translucent. Add the minced garlic and cook for an additional minute until fragrant.
Step 3: Add the Remaining Ingredients
Return the beef to the pot. Add the carrots, potatoes, peas, corn, diced tomatoes, beef broth, soy sauce, Worcestershire sauce, thyme, rosemary, salt, and black pepper. Stir well to combine all the ingredients.
Step 4: Simmer the Stew
Bring the mixture to a boil, then reduce the heat to low. Cover the pot and let it simmer for about 1.5 to 2 hours, or until the beef is tender and the vegetables are cooked through. Stir occasionally to prevent sticking.
Step 5: Add Hawaiian Flavors
In a small bowl, mix the pineapple juice and coconut milk. Stir this mixture into the stew. Continue to simmer for an additional 10 minutes to allow the flavors to meld together.
Step 6: Thicken the Stew
In a separate small bowl, mix the cornstarch with water to create a slurry. Gradually add the slurry to the stew, stirring continuously until the stew thickens to your desired consistency.
Step 7: Serve
Ladle the Beef Stew Recipe Hawaii into bowls and garnish with fresh cilantro. Serve hot with crusty bread or rice to soak up the delicious broth.
Nutritional Information
Understanding the nutritional value of your Beef Stew Recipe Hawaii can help you make informed decisions about your diet. Here’s a breakdown of the nutritional information per serving:
| Nutrient | Amount per Serving |
|---|---|
| Calories | 450 |
| Protein | 35g |
| Total Fat | 20g |
| Carbohydrates | 30g |
| Fiber | 5g |
| Sugar | 10g |
| Sodium | 1200mg |
These values are approximate and can vary based on the specific ingredients and brands used.
Variations of Beef Stew Recipe Hawaii
One of the best things about the Beef Stew Recipe Hawaii is its versatility. You can easily customize it to suit your tastes or dietary needs. Here are a few variations to consider:
- Spicy Version: Add diced jalapeños or a pinch of red pepper flakes for a spicy kick.
- Vegetarian Version: Replace the beef with hearty vegetables like mushrooms, bell peppers, and zucchini. Use vegetable broth instead of beef broth.
- Slow Cooker Version: Combine all the ingredients in a slow cooker and cook on low for 8-10 hours. This method allows the flavors to meld together beautifully.
- Coconut Milk Variation: Increase the amount of coconut milk for a creamier, more tropical flavor.
Feel free to experiment with different ingredients and adjust the seasoning to make the Beef Stew Recipe Hawaii your own.
